Exploring PRP for Shoulder Injuries Partial-thickness rotator cuff tears are common shoulder injuries that can cause pain, weakness, and difficulty with everyday movement. These tears affect part of the rotator cuff tendon and may become more troublesome over time. One regenerative approach being studied is platelet-rich plasma (PRP).
